The Purification Process Behind Kirkland Water

Long before it reaches the bottle, the water undergoes a journey of transformation. As confirmed by its manufacturer, Niagara Bottling, Kirkland water begins its life sourced from various locations, including wells, springs, and even municipal water systems. It's the subsequent purification that sets it apart, ensuring consistency and safety regardless of its initial source. The process involves:

  • Micron Filtration: This initial stage removes larger particles and sediment, providing a cleaner starting point.
  • Reverse Osmosis (RO): A key technology in the process, RO forces water through a semipermeable membrane to remove almost all dissolved solids, contaminants, and impurities. This is far more intensive than basic filtration.
  • Ozone Disinfection: Ozone is used as a powerful disinfectant to kill any remaining microorganisms, ensuring the water is microbiologically safe without leaving any chemical residue or odor.
  • Automated Digital Imaging: During bottling, each bottle is inspected using automated digital imaging to ensure it meets the highest quality and safety standards.

The Taste of Purity: Minerals for Palatability

After the water is stripped of its impurities through reverse osmosis, it is essentially tasteless. This is where the proprietary mineral blend comes into play, creating the unique and appealing flavor that fans love. A small amount of food-grade minerals is added back to enhance the taste and provide a satisfying mouthfeel. The specific minerals used include sodium bicarbonate, potassium bicarbonate, calcium citrate, sodium chloride, and magnesium oxide. Each mineral serves a purpose in balancing the flavor profile. For example, calcium can improve the water's mouthfeel, while magnesium contributes to its refreshing quality. It is this precise balance of minerals that prevents the water from tasting flat or metallic, a common complaint with less-processed purified waters.

Kirkland Water and Your Nutritional Diet

From a nutrition and diet perspective, the quality and taste of your water are crucial for encouraging sufficient fluid intake. A water that tastes great is one you're more likely to drink consistently throughout the day. This constant hydration aids in a multitude of bodily functions:

  • Optimal Hydration: Supports sustained energy levels and physical performance, which is especially important for active individuals.
  • Nutrient Transport: Ensures vitamins, minerals, and other essential nutrients are effectively transported to your cells.
  • Detoxification: Helps flush out toxins from the body.
  • Weight Management: Contributes to a feeling of fullness and can aid in calorie control.

Kirkland vs. Other Brands: A Comparison

To understand why Kirkland water is so highly regarded, it's helpful to compare it to other popular bottled water brands. While many big names use advanced filtration, the source and mineral blend vary significantly, leading to distinct taste profiles.

Feature Kirkland Signature Purified Water Dasani Aquafina
Sourcing Wells, springs, municipal sources Municipal water supplies Municipal water supplies
Purification Multi-stage, including reverse osmosis and ozone Multi-stage filtration Multi-stage filtration
Mineral Addition Proprietary blend added for taste Magnesium sulfate, potassium chloride Proprietary mineral blend
Taste Profile Consistently pure, clean, and refreshing Can have a slightly mineral, salty taste Tends to be very neutral, some perceive it as flat
BPA-Free Bottles Yes, utilizing recycled PET where feasible Yes, though some dislike the packaging quality Yes
